Chapter 1 Who Did Patrick’s Homework

1.    What did Patrick think his cat was playing with? What was it really?
Ans: Patrick thought that his cat was playing with a little doll. It was, in fact, a very small-sized man, an elf.

2.    Why did the little man grant Patrick a wish?
Ans: Patrick had saved the tiny man’s life from the cat by not handing him back to the cat. So he promised to fulfil one wish of Patrick.

3.    What was Patrick’s wish?
Ans: Patrick hated doing homework. His greatest wish was that the little man should do all his homework till the end of the session.

4.    In what subjects did the little man need help, to do Patrick’s homework?
Ans: The little man needed Patrick’s help in maths, English and history.

5.    How did Patrick help him?
Ans: Patrick sat beside the little man and guided him. He brought books from the library and read out to him.

6.    Who do you think did Patrick’s homework – the little man, or Patrick himself? Give reasons for your answer.
Ans: It was Patrick himself who actually did all the homework. He had to help the elf again and again with guidance and books.

7.    Who did Patrick’s homework? Why and how?
Ans: Patrick had no interest in studies. He hated doing homework. He was lucky to get a helper. It was an elf. He had saved the elf from a cat and the elf promised to do all Patrick’s homework for 35 days. But the poor elf was blank in English. and maths. He sought Patrick’s help and guidance. Patrick brought books from the library and worked hard to solve all sums. He got good marks. Actually, it was Patrick himself who did all his homework.

8.    How did Patrick get supernatural help? Was the elf intelligent enough to answer questions in all the subjects?
Ans: One day Patrick found his cat playing with a doll. He rescued the tiny doll, who in fact was an elf. He promised to grant his saviour one wish. Patrick told him to do all his homework for 35 days. The elf had to keep his word. But he was quite ignorant of language and maths and even other subjects. He called out to Patrick to come and guide him.

9.    Give the characteristic features of the elf which helped Patrick.
Ans: Patrick saved a little doll from his cat. That doll was, in fact, a very small sized man, an elf. He was timid. He felt grateful to his saviour. In return, he prom­ised to grant Patrick a wish. He could not say ‘no’ to any of Patrick’s requests. He agreed to do Patrick’s homework. But he was illiterate. He sought Patrick’s guidance at every step.
